The Story of Yulianna

Yulianna is the Slavic form of Juliana, itself the feminine of Julian, from the Roman family name Julius. The ultimate origin is believed to come from the Latin 'iulus' or from the Greek 'ioulos' meaning downy-bearded, young. Through the Roman Empire it spread across Europe, and the Slavic form Yulianna developed the distinctive Y- spelling characteristic of East Slavic pronunciation patterns.

Yulianna is consistently popular in Russia, Ukraine, and Kazakhstan, where it ranks among the top girls' names. In Spanish-speaking countries a similar form Yuliana also appears. The spelling with Y- is distinctly Eastern European and helps differentiate it from the Western Juliana.

The name has strong royal and religious associations in the Slavic world, including Saint Juliana of Lazarevo, a revered Russian Orthodox saint. In Spain and Latin America, the Y spelling Yuliana reflects the influence of naming trends from former Soviet states on immigrant communities.

Historical Record

Yulianna first appeared in US Social Security records in 1989.

Over 1,372 babies have been named Yulianna in the United States since SSA records began.

Today, Yulianna is a hidden gem — rare but distinctive , currently ranked #4,516 for girl names in the US .

Famous People Named Yulianna

Y

Yulianna Avdeeva

Musician

1985

Russian classical pianist and winner of the International Chopin Piano Competition in 2010

S

Saint Juliana of Lazarevo

Religious

1530

Russian Orthodox saint revered for her charity and compassion toward peasants and the poor
